AND FEATURING THE LAZY BOY CLASSIC 2 MILE SADDLE DONKEY RACE.
This race brings back the excitement of The Old West as miners and their Burros raced back to Columbus, NM to be the first to file on their hopefully mineral rich claims in the Tres Hermanas Mountains. $50.00 entrance fee.
